On 06/12/2018 06:06 PM, Hanby, Mike wrote:
Is anyone aware of any existing job completion email scripts that
provide a summary of the jobs resource utilization? For example,
something like:
Job ID: 123456
Cluster: HPC
User/Group: jdoe/jdoe
State: COMPLETED (exit code 0)
Cores: 1
CPU Utilization: 00:18:45
CPU Efficiency: 98.60% of 00:19:01 core-walltime
Memory Utilization 7.53 MB
Memory Efficiency: 75.3% of 10 MB
I've come up empty Google'ing and figured I'd ask here before coding my own.
How about the Slurm tool seff?
# rpm -qf /usr/bin/seff
slurm-contribs-17.11.7-1.el7.x86_64
See a description in https://bugs.schedmd.com/show_bug.cgi?id=1611
